I. Why is the Drying Stage a "Value Hotspot"?
Many mining companies focus on key stages such as crushing, grinding, and magnetic separation, neglecting the crucial drying process that bridges these stages. Improperly dried iron ore has unstable moisture content, directly leading to:
• Low grinding efficiency: Excessive moisture exacerbates the "ball-sticking" phenomenon in the mill, significantly reducing grinding efficiency and increasing power consumption.
• Soaring Transportation Costs: Transporting excess moisture results in exorbitant and unnecessary freight charges.
• Damaged Grade and Price: Moisture content is a crucial indicator in iron ore concentrate trading; excessive moisture leads to product downgrading and significant price reductions.
Therefore, investing in an advanced dryer is a wise move to plug cost loopholes at the source and increase product added value.
II. How to Develop a Keen Eye for Quality?
Faced with a dazzling array of equipment on the market, how do you make the optimal choice? You need to focus on the following core dimensions:
1. Thermal Efficiency and Energy Consumption: This is the primary standard for measuring the advancement of a dryer. Traditional single-drum dryers often have a thermal efficiency of only 40%-60%, while new-generation three-pass dryers or steam dryers, through multi-layer insulation and waste heat recovery technologies, can increase thermal efficiency to over 80%, resulting in immediate energy savings.
2. Adaptability and Stability: Iron ore from different sources varies in particle size, initial moisture content, and viscosity. An excellent dryer should possess strong material adaptability, with a scientifically designed internal lifting plate to ensure even distribution and smooth passage of materials within the drum, avoiding under-drying or over-drying, and guaranteeing consistently compliant output moisture content.
3. Environmental Protection and Automation: With tightening environmental policies, dust removal and desulfurization capabilities have become entry-level requirements for equipment. Simultaneously, the adoption of a PLC automatic control system enables one-button start/stop and online monitoring of temperature and humidity, reducing human error and costs, and representing a crucial step towards intelligent mining.
4. Durability and Maintenance Costs: Dryers operate year-round in high-temperature, high-wear environments. The main body material (e.g., heat-resistant manganese steel), insulation layer thickness, and manufacturing processes of key components (e.g., rollers, support rollers) directly determine the equipment's lifespan and failure rate. Choosing equipment with superior internal quality translates to lower overall operating costs in the long run.
